Denison motor yacht Zantino III sold

26 July 2021 • Written by Malcolm MacLean

The 32.4 metre Denison motor yacht Zantino III, listed for sale by Yannis Zagorakis at Hargrave Custom Yachts and Denison Yachting, has been sold with the buyer introduced by Kit Denison of Denison Yachting.

Built in aluminium by Denison Marine to a design by Joe Langlois, she was delivered in 1986 and most recently refitted in 2016. Originally built as a four stateroom yacht, her two forward cabins were converted into one very large full beam master suite and she has a further double and a twin, all with entertainment centres and en suite bathroom facilities.

She has dual sliding stainless steel doors that lead into the spacious main saloon where large windows illuminate the beautiful teak panelling, inlaid with lighter burled ash. A grand piano is in the port aft corner, with several seating areas to encourage relaxation or casual conversation. Forward is a dining area with seating for six guests.

The large aft deck provides all that guests could need for al fresco entertaining including a table and chairs sheltered by a large awing. Up on the flybridge, a full wet bar with fridge, ice maker, and ample storage space is under the mast island. U-Shaped welded aluminum seating provides seating for over 15 guests, as well as storage underneath.

Twin 1,400hp Caterpillar diesel engine enable a cruising speed of 20 knots topping out at 24 knots.

Zantino III was asking $795,000.
